U.S. Embassy Tokyo: Promote Study abroad to the United States - Graduate Schools: Announcing an open competition to promoting study abroad, focusing on U.S. graduate educational institutions. American and/or Japanese non-profit organizations may submit proposals to manage and administer innovative and creative programs designed to increase the number of Japanese students studying in U.S. graduate schools in a variety of fields.
